About the Role

Royal Prince Alfred is the principal teaching hospital of the University of Sydney and offers speciality services from its main campus as well as from Institute of Rheumatology and Orthopaedics, Chris O’Brien Lifehouse and Dame Edith Walker Hospitals. RPAH is one of Australia's leading hospitals, providing an extensive range of diagnostic and treatment services. Its specialities include cardiology, obstetrics and gynaecology, cancer, respiratory medicine, neurology, liver and kidney transplants.

  

The function of this position is to provide assistance to Nursing, Midwifery and other health service workers in delivering effective patient care. This is a support role with a scope of duties that encompasses, but is not limited by, tidying, cleaning and duties associated with direct patient care.
